Oracle

Software Developer - Implementation of Oracle Utilities

Posted: 2 days ago

Job Description

Job DescriptionSeeking experienced Technical Designer/Senior Developer candidates to support global Oracle implementation projects. Candidates must be skilled in developing high-quality, efficient code from solution-driven designs, with the ability to incorporate automation and artificial intelligence (AI) to optimize Utilities customer solutions. Experience translating functional requirements into technical specifications is a strong advantage.Qualifications3–5 years of overall experience in relevant functional or technical roles. Practice focus in IT consulting, systems development, or offshore services is preferred.Applied experience in Java, Groovy, or object-oriented software development and testing.Advantage: Experience in Oracle Utilities products, the Oracle Utilities Application Framework (OUAF), or similar applications (e.g., Customer Cloud Service (CCS), Customer to Meter (C2M), Customer Care & Billing (CC&B), Meter Solution Cloud Service (MSCS), Data Management (MDM), Work Asset Cloud Service (WACS), Work Asset Management (WAM)).Exposure to automation frameworks (e.g., CI/CD pipelines, test automation, robotic process automation) and AI/ML technologies (e.g., predictive analytics, natural language processing, anomaly detection).Understanding of how AI and automation can enhance Utilities implementations—for example: Predictive maintenance for assets and meters. Intelligent customer engagement via chatbots and virtual assistants. Smart grid optimization using AI-driven forecasting. Automated data management and reconciliation for billing and consumption data.Good oral/written communication skills, with the ability to explain complex AI/automation solutions in business terms.ResponsibilitiesConvert Technical Design specifications into high-quality working code, incorporating automation where feasible to streamline delivery and testing.Prepare unit test documentation of scenarios/test cases. Perform automated unit and regression testing, leveraging AI-assisted testing tools where appropriate.Ensure the quality of deliverables through adherence to project standards and methodologies, including AI-enabled code review or quality-checking tools.Provide support during system testing, user acceptance testing, Go-Live and maintenance support phases, including the use of AI-driven monitoring to proactively detect issues.Assist in the clarification and resolution of issues as they arise during the design and development process, leveraging AI-based diagnostic tools when available.Contribute to project release activities and support automation of deployment and release processes.Collaborate with clients to identify opportunities where AI and automation can drive efficiencies, improve customer experience, or reduce operational costs in Utilities implementations.QualificationsCareer Level - IC2About UsAs a world leader in cloud solutions, Oracle uses tomorrow’s technology to tackle today’s challenges. We’ve partnered with industry-leaders in almost every sector—and continue to thrive after 40+ years of change by operating with integrity.We know that true innovation starts when everyone is empowered to contribute. That’s why we’re committed to growing an inclusive workforce that promotes opportunities for all.Oracle careers open the door to global opportunities where work-life balance flourishes. We offer competitive benefits based on parity and consistency and support our people with flexible medical, life insurance, and retirement options. We also encourage employees to give back to their communities through our volunteer programs.We’re committed to including people with disabilities at all stages of the employment process. If you require accessibility assistance or accommodation for a disability at any point, let us know by emailing accommodation-request_mb@oracle.com or by calling +1 888 404 2494 in the United States.Oracle is an Equal Employment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ability and protected veterans’ status, or any other characteristic protected by law. Oracle will consider for employment qualified applicants with arrest and conviction records pursuant to applicable law.

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

Related Jobs